Specifications

The VWR Vwr Thermometer 10/45c 4/0045 is a precision instrument designed for accurate temperature measurement within a specific range. Its temperature scale covers 10 to 45 degrees Celsius, making it ideal for applications like incubation, controlled storage, or general lab monitoring where ambient temperatures don’t fluctuate wildly outside this band. The unit is filled with a blue spirit liquid, which is a safer and more environmentally friendly alternative to mercury.

This thermometer also boasts a statement of accuracy traceable to NIST, a crucial detail for any laboratory or regulated environment. This traceability assures users that the instrument has been calibrated against national standards, providing confidence in its readings. Each thermometer also comes with its own unique serial number, further aiding in tracking and calibration records. The Advantech Manufacturing unit measures 102 mm in length, a compact size that allows it to fit easily within most standard laboratory equipment without taking up excessive space.
